What does a swim lessons instructor do?

A Swim Lessons Instructor is responsible for teaching individuals or groups how to swim, ensuring they learn essential water safety skills and swimming techniques. Instructors typically work with children, but may also teach adults or people with special needs. Their duties include planning lessons, demonstrating swimming strokes, monitoring students for safety, and providing feedback to help improve technique. They often work at pools, fitness centers, or community centers and must be certified in first aid and CPR. Swim Lessons Instructors play a vital role in helping students gain confidence and competence in the water.

What are some common challenges faced by swim lessons instructors, and how can they be managed?

Swim Lessons Instructors often encounter challenges such as managing students with varying skill levels within the same class, addressing water-related anxieties, and maintaining safety while keeping lessons engaging. Effective instructors use clear communication, adapt lesson plans, and build trust to help nervous swimmers feel comfortable. Collaborating closely with other instructors and lifeguards also ensures a safe and supportive environment, allowing for quick responses to any issues that arise.

How do I become a certified swim lessons instructor?

To become a certified swim lessons instructor, you typically need to complete a recognized lifeguard certification, such as CPR and first aid, and obtain swim instructor certification through organizations like the American Red Cross or YMCA. These programs often require passing a skills assessment and may include coursework on teaching techniques and water safety. Having strong swimming skills and experience working with diverse age groups is also important.

1. Job Summary:

The Swim Instructor is responsible for providing swimming instruction to people of all ages, following the YMCA of the USA Aquatics and Swim Lessons guidelines. Swim Instructors will provide excellent customer service in a safe, enjoyable, and positive atmosphere that promotes member safety and satisfaction in accordance with the YMCA policies and procedures.

2. Essential Functions:

  • Provide swimming instruction to students of various ages and ability levels.
  • Maintain constant supervision of students, watch for swimmers needing assistance, and aid swimmers when necessary to ensure positive learning environment.
  • Know, understand, and consistently communicate policies and procedures for the pool and whirlpool.
  • Understand the YMCA Swim Lessons program, including swimming levels and skills taught for each level. Evaluate students and recommend placement in the correct skill level.

3. Relationships:

This position reports to the Aquatic Supervisor/Aquatics Director who reports to the Branch Community Leadership. The incumbent interacts regularly with their supervisor, staff, volunteers, and participants.

4. Qualifications:

Required:

  • Minimum age of 16.
  • Completed YSL V6: Observe & Communicate, YSL V6: Orientation Principles of Youth Development, YMCA Swim Instructor Skills Verification.
  • BLS/CPR + AED for the Professional Rescuer annually, First Aid certifications and Oxygen Certification within 120 days of hire
  • Patience and the ability to communicate with all ages and levels of swimmers.
  • Demonstrated ability to swim in shallow and deep water, and tread water (Stage 4 level swimming skill).
  • Dedicated to member safety and the mission and philosophy of the YMCA.

Preferred:

  • YMCA Swim Instructor certification.

5. Work Conditions:

  • Must remain in the pool area at all times.
  • Ability to support child or adult body weight in the water.
  • Must be able to remain alert with no lapses of consciousness in a warm environment with air temperatures of 80 degrees or higher.
  • Demonstrated ability to recognize and remedy hazardous/dangerous situations.
  • Ability to recognize and react calmly and effectively in hazardous/dangerous situations.
  • Communicate verbally, including projecting voice across distance in normal and loud situations.
  • Perform all physical aspects of the position, including walking, standing, bending, reaching, and lifting up to 50 pounds at a time in a warm pool environment.
